Thermal Interface Materials

Thermally conductive silicone cloth can effectively reduce the thermal resistance between electronic components and heat sinks, and is electrically insulated, has high dielectric strength, good thermal conductivity, high chemical resistance, and can withstand high voltage and circuit short circuits caused by metal piercing. It is used in switching power supplies, communication equipment, computers, flat-panel TVs, mobile devices, video equipment, network products, home appliances, etc.

Mylar sheet material

Mylar sheet is dimensionally stable, straight, has excellent tearing strength, is heat-resistant, cold-resistant, moisture-resistant, water-resistant, chemical-resistant, and has super insulation properties, excellent electrical, mechanical, heat-resistant, and chemical-resistant properties. It can be used as insulation material for motors, capacitors, coils, and cables. It is now widely used in the electrical insulation industry and is suitable for gaskets, baffles, screens, and protective functions in electronics, household appliances, instruments, displays, motor slots, computers, and peripheral equipment.

Foam material

Foam has a series of characteristics such as elasticity, light weight, fast pressure-sensitive fixation, easy use, easy bending, ultra-thin volume, reliable performance, etc. It is used as the bottom pads of various electronic products, household appliances, furniture, handicrafts, instruments and meters, and toys. It is shock-absorbing, anti-slip, wear-resistant and scratch-resistant.

Mylar tablets

Mylar sheets are available in a variety of colors, including milky white, black, natural color, and transparent. Mylar sheets are available in a variety of materials, such as PET Mylar sheets, PVC Mylar sheets, PC Mylar sheets, and fireproof Mylar sheets. They are divided into insulation type, buffer type, wear-resistant type, sealing type, and appearance decorative type Mylar sheets.

Foam material

The elasticity and lightness of foam provide good protection in various devices, while the fast pressure-sensitive fixing ability facilitates assembly and use. Due to its ultra-thin volume, foam can effectively save space and adapt to different design requirements. In addition, the bendability of foam can flexibly cope with various shapes and structures, ensuring reliability in electronic products.

Thermal Interface Materials

Thermal interface materials are mainly used to fill the tiny gaps between electronic components and heat sinks, eliminate the thermal resistance caused by air, and ensure that heat is more effectively transferred from components to heat sinks. This not only improves heat dissipation efficiency, but also reduces the operating temperature of the equipment and prolongs its service life.
